The story of Israel Robertson Sr. began in 1695 in Tisbury, Marthas Vineyard, MA, USA. Israel Robertson Sr. married Deborah Chapman, Sarah Sabin, and had children including Abagail Robinson, Daniel Robinson, Eleizer Robinson, Elisha Robinson, James Robinson. Israel Robertson Sr. passed away in 1775 in Fredrick, Virginia, United States.
